Instructions
In a large pot, heat some oil over medium heat. Add the diced onion and cook until softened, about 5 minutes.
Add the minced garlic and grated ginger to the pot. Cook for another 1-2 minutes until fragrant.
Add the curry powder, turmeric powder, cumin powder, cayenne pepper (if using), and salt to the pot. Stir well to coat the onions, garlic, and ginger with the spices.
Add the rinsed and drained red lentils to the pot. Stir to combine with the spices and onion mixture.
Pour in the coconut milk and tomato paste. Stir well to combine all the ingredients. Bring the mixture to a boil, then reduce the heat to low and cover the pot. Let simmer for about 20 minutes, or until the lentils are tender.
